Abstract

Devices, systems and methods for controlling gap height for posterior resection in a partial knee arthroplasty can comprise A) use robotic surgery planning software to adjust an extension gap to suit a flexion gap to manually position a manual posterior cut guide; B) use a surgical navigation system to determine a femur rotation axis to properly manually position a manual posterior cut guide; C1) use shims to adjust the position of a manual posterior cut guide; C2) use a robotically-guided femur and tibia partial cut guide block to position a robot-configured posterior cut guide relative to the distal end of a femur; and D) use a robotically-guided femur and tibia partial cut guide block to guide pin holes for a robot-configured posterior cut guide relative to the distal end of a femur.
